In addition to thermal performance, rigid mineral wool boards also provide superior acoustic insulation. Their porous nature helps to absorb sound, making them a preferred choice for spaces requiring noise reduction. This quality is particularly beneficial in offices, schools, and residential buildings where sound control is crucial for comfort and productivity.

The T-Bar is a fundamental element of drop ceiling designs, providing both structural support and aesthetic appeal in modern interiors. Its benefits, including flexibility, accessibility, and affordability, make it a preferred choice among designers and homeowners alike. As the trend for versatile and functional spaces continues to grow, the T-Bar drop ceiling system will likely remain a staple in both commercial and residential designs, proving to be an essential feature for any creatively designed space. Whether seeking to enhance a home office or create a calming environment in a commercial setting, the T-Bar grid offers an elegant solution that balances form and function.
